By Donovan James, Trojans Wire: This is a roster question which will loom large for USC in the coming weeks. Raleek Brown, a dynamic 5-foot-8 running back with plenty of speed and obvious potential, got the call to play Saturday night when MarShawn Lloyd got scratched due to injury.
The USC Trojans took a 52-42 loss to Washington at home, but it wasn’t due to a lack of offense.
